New research reveals cascading visibility failures create a perfect storm of vulnerability across enterprises globally. When we launched this research series four years ago, we expected to document steady progress in enterprise security. Instead, we’ve uncovered a troubling reality that’s getting worse, not better: 46% of companies don’t know how often they’re breached. This isn’t Read more...